Bowl Patrol

Bowl Patrol is New Zealand’s only national junior tenpin bowling program designed specifically for primary school-aged children.

It is an 8 session program that is adaptable and utilises modifications to make learning to bowl fun.

It teaches the fundamental skills of the sport, improves co-ordinations and balance, allowing all abilities and ages to play within the same program.

Bowl Patrol is FAST, FUN and ACTIVE and promotes skill development, a sense of achievement, socialisation and teamwork.

Program Features

8 SESSION PROGRAM: 60 minutes sessions, recommended once per week.

ON THE MOVE: Maximum of 3 children per lane so they are always active.

SHORTENED LANES: Modified length to match ability of each child (9m, 12m, 15m, full length)

SHORTENED GAMES: 5-Frame games (half a normal game) to keep children focussed.

CHALLENGING: No bumpers of ramps used to ensure skill technique development.

6 LEVELS of ACHIEVEMENT: Progression based on skill not age.

MODIFIED SCORING: Simplified scoring in early stages, score what you knock down.

LANE RANGERS: Program delivered by trained facilitators.

REWARDING: Recognition of individual achievements and progress.
